REVEALED: This is when Chelsea will officially announce the signing of Timo Werner

Timo Werner has agreed to join Chelsea after the Blues triggered his £49 million release clause and offered him a five year contract with wages of £200,000 weekly.

According to The Express, Chelsea may announce their signing of RB Leipzig striker Timo Werner by the end of the week.

Chelsea fans are already getting excited for next season following the club’s signing of Hakim Ziyech and Timo Werner. The Blues have also opened negotiations with Bayer Leverkusen over the transfer of Kai Havertz, who has scored 11 goals and registered five assists this season.

Meanwhile, Michael Owen, has compared Chelsea-bound striker, Timo Werner, with Fernando Torres, a player who was sensational for Liverpool but who flopped at Stamford Bridge.

“The Bundesliga is a very strong league and you would say that he can translate that,” Owen said on Premier League Productions.

“He does it at international level as well. I’ve been watching him quite closely since the restart and he’s already started scoring goals, he’s very quick, can cut in from wide, times his runs brilliantly and he’s very direct as well, straight at the goal, a bit like Torres.

“I don’t think he plays exactly the same but I always used to feel that Torres would take that first touch and then be motoring forward. I like him a lot. “I’m sure Liverpool wanted him but maybe the financial implications and where we’re standing in the world at the moment put them off… but I’m pretty sure they wanted him.”
